Dewayne Bevil | Sentinel Staff Writer September 26, 2008 WHAT: Long-spinning game show Wheel of Fortune will tape episodes at SeaWorld Orlando in December, but before that can happen, producers must find contestants. The first opportunities for locals to vie for big money and vowel-buying will be this weekend at the theme park. Hopefuls will fill out applications there, which will lead to random selection of potential players. (Translation: Luck required.)

Those folk will compete in a simulated version of the game. Prizes will be awarded.

From that pool of people, Wheel officials will select some to advance to additional auditions later this fall. It's fair to say that energy and enthusiasm will count for something.

A similar audition will be held Oct. 4-5 at Seminole Towne Center in Sanford.
